Federal court lacked jurisdiction over purely state law claims alleging nuisance and consumer fraud arising from fossil fuel companies' purported disinformation campaigns to suppress the link between fossil fuel products and climate damage.

Limited partners' fiduciary claims survived dismissal where limited partners could rely on misleading disclosures regarding challenged transactions, where the general partners and controllers failed to eliminate fiduciary duties from the partnership agreement, and where general partner's financial interest in challenged transactions was sufficient to establish demand futility.
